1. Refresh Your Walls with a New Coat of Paint

The most basic, quickest and most affordable remodeling you can provide your home is to paint ... your home. Whether you are revamping your living room, revitalising your bedroom or revamping your bathroom, the sensible use of paint will create the impression of an entirely alternative and changed building.

Think Colour: Smaller rooms, with restricted natural light and furnishings, will constantly look better painted in lighter shades; a bathroom renovation project with warm, yellow paint might feel more welcoming than an eerily lit blue-tinged room in the back of your home. Bolder, darker tones enrich big rooms, adding character to a vast living room that lacks many people.

2. Upgrade Your Lighting Fixtures

Altering a room's lighting can make a substantial difference to its ambience. It's one of the simplest fixes for providing a room an entire new feel (and can be an exceptional reason for renovating your kitchen).

Why Lighting Matters: Good lighting improves state of mind, performance, and the total appearance of a space. Upgrade living room accents and kitchen task lighting for a different night and day.

4. Create a Gallery Wall

A gallery wall or wall gallery is the ideal way to add some character to your home, be it in the living room, corridor or bedroom. They offer an unique method of showing and accenting art work, photographs and souvenirs in a trendy and coordinated fashion.

Picking Art: mix and match pieces of various sizes and shapes to add dimension and interest. Photographs of family members, artwork or mirrors can all work beautifully. Attempt laying the pieces on the floor until you get a structure that you like.

Shopping List: Tape measureLevelPicture hooksPainter's tape To build a reputable gallery wall, you'll need all that will get you a professional-looking outcome; it just takes some preparation. Start by drawing up each piece on your wall with tape before you start hammering in picture hooks. That way, the pieces will all be similarly spaced and sitting straight.

How to Hang Pictures So That They Are Even? Start off with the initially largest piece, then do a circulation from the centre outside. Make sure the spacing from one frame to the other is the same and each piece is relatively straight with a level.

5. Revamp Your Cabinets with New Hardware

If your kitchen or bathroom could utilize a boost, an efforlessly simple upgrade is changing out the old cabinet handles and knobs for new ones. This can truly freshen up that room and offer it a "lift" without the expense of doing a kitchen remodel or total bathroom remodel.

Impact of New Hardware: New handles, knobs or pulls can alter the look of cabinets totally. Brushed nickel or matte black hardware is ideal for a modern look, while antique brass or ceramic knobs will add a standard touch.

7. Add a Pop of Color with an Accent Wall

One of the quickest and most convenient methods to redecorate a room is to add an accent wall. Whether you paint or apply wallpaper, an accent wall can anchor the room and add dimension.

Picking the Right Wall and Colour: Find a wall that is already a centerpiece, one behind the bed in the bedroom maybe or the fireplace in the living room, and opt for that. Dark colours-- deep blues, greens or even reds-- are dramatic, while more sombre neutral tones are calming.
